SVASE MAIN EVENT: Angel Investors – Alive, Kicking & Investing
Angel investing has been down substantially following the dot.com bust, but is now showing signs of recovery. How have the dynamics and metrics of Angel investing changed during this time? Is becoming an Angel still an attractive investing option? What are the metrics Angels look for in their investments today? What technologies & deals are most attractive to Angel investors right now? And what types of people are becoming Angels Investors, and why?
The Panel:
• Stewart Sonnenfeldt, Managing Director, Sand Hill Angels • Laura Roden, Managing Director, The Angels Forum • Randy Williams, Founder & CEO, Keiretsu Forum • Antonio Salerno, Deal Selection Committee, Band of Angels
Moderator: David Frazee, corporate/IP shareholder, Greenberg Traurig
